Do you need medical assistance during a stay abroad? Your Dutch health insurance sometimes covers the costs, depending on the country and the nature of the care.

Medical Assistance within the EU/EEA

In the EU, EEA countries, and Switzerland, you are entitled to essential medical care. With the European Health Insurance Card (EHIC), you receive care under the same conditions as the local population.

European Health Insurance Card (EHIC)

You can apply for the EHIC free of charge from your health insurer:

  • No costs associated with the application
  • Valid in EU, EEA, and Switzerland
  • Right to necessary medical treatment
  • Treatment via public healthcare institutions

Outside the EU/EEA

Outside the EU/EEA, coverage is limited:

  • Coverage up to the Dutch rate
  • Often required to pay yourself first
  • Additional travel insurance is recommended

Frequently Asked Questions about Care Abroad

Do I have to advance costs abroad myself?

Within the EU often not, thanks to the EHIC. Outside the EU, you usually have to pay first and claim reimbursement later.

Will I be brought back to the Netherlands in case of an accident?

Repatriation is not included in the basic insurance. For this, you need supplementary or travel insurance.

Can I deliberately go abroad for treatment?

This is possible, but you must obtain prior approval from your insurer. Without permission, you risk limited reimbursement.
